The narrative explores the tumultuous world of late-night television, focusing on NBC's controversial decision to replace Jay Leno with Conan O'Brien as host of The Tonight Show. Bill Carter, a seasoned media reporter, chronicles the high-stakes drama that ensued, including plummeting ratings and discontent among affiliates. As Jeff Zucker's plans unravel, the book delves into the complexities of the comedy business and the challenges of managing celebrity egos, making it a compelling examination of a pivotal moment in television history.
